Patsy was born on March 17, 1933 at Anthon, Iowa to Edwin & Opal (Palmer) Prescott. She had been a resident of the Correctionville Specialty Care the past four years and prior to this had lived in Cherokee, Iowa for many years.
Patsy loved her family, especially her children. She worked very hard to provide for them. She canned fruits and veggies many times late into the night. She would buy large clothing at a thrift store and use the fabric to make clothes for her children. Patsy worked several jobs throughout her life, but there were always lots of hugs and kisses and homemade cookies.
Patsy was an artist; she enjoyed reading, knitting, crocheting, flowers, loved watching and feeding the birds, and the cats.
